Financial Performance Highlights - The company reported record collections of $245 million, an increase of 41% year-over-year [3][4] - Revenue for the quarter reached $155 million, up 30% compared to the prior year [4][17] - Adjusted EPS for the quarter was $0.69, with adjusted pre-tax income of $51 million, reflecting a 15% year-over-year increase [4][18] - The Cash Efficiency Ratio for the quarter was 71%, driven by strong collections from the Conn's portfolio purchase [4][16] Business Line Performance - Collections from the Conn's portfolio contributed $36 million for the quarter, while the Bluestem portfolio added $14 million [10] - The company achieved record deployments of $381 million, up 6% from the previous year [3][12] - Estimated remaining collections reached $3.4 billion, a 23% increase year-over-year [4][13] Market and Economic Context - Delinquency trends remain elevated across non-mortgage consumer asset classes, creating favorable portfolio supply conditions [5][7] - Personal savings levels have decreased to $831 billion, significantly lower than pre-pandemic averages, indicating limited consumer ability to absorb financial hardships [6] - The insolvency market has seen an increase in the number of insolvencies, fueling supply for insolvency portfolios [6][7] Company Strategy and Competitive Position - The company aims to maintain a strong focus on deploying capital for portfolio purchases at attractive risk-adjusted returns [20][22] - The company has improved its operational efficiency and has a robust funding structure, positioning it well for future opportunities [9][20] - The company intends to remain disciplined and opportunistic in M&A activities while focusing on organic growth [22] Management Commentary on Future Outlook - Management expressed confidence in the investment opportunity, citing favorable trends in consumer delinquencies and charge-offs [7][8] - The company anticipates that the Bluestem portfolio will significantly contribute to financial results in 2026 [4][19] - Management noted that the current economic environment is likely to be a net positive for supply-side opportunities [27][28] Other Important Information - The company completed a follow-on offering that improved liquidity and reduced ownership concentration [3] - A quarterly dividend of $0.24 per share was declared, representing a 4.7% annualized yield [22] - The company repurchased 3 million shares as part of a tactical strategy to support the follow-on offering [22] Q&A Session Summary Question: Thoughts on macro uncertainties affecting purchasing environment - Management indicated that while energy costs and employment changes may impact delinquencies, they do not foresee significant effects on liquidation rates [27][28] Question: Trends among sellers regarding forward flow deals - Management noted that about half of deployments have historically been in forward flows, but they do not target a specific percentage [30] Question: Expected efficiency ratio trends with portfolio changes - Management expects a substitution effect as the Conn's portfolio runs off, but anticipates maintaining a strong efficiency ratio through ongoing improvements [36] Question: Insights on supply increase and return profiles - Management stated that supply levels have been stable, and return profiles remain attractive with consistent pricing [48] Question: Characteristics of deployments and market shifts - Management highlighted an increase in deployments in insolvencies and noted that their geographic and asset class diversification continues to yield attractive returns [56] Question: Legal channel performance and profitability - Management confirmed that the volume of legal accounts aligns with underwritten expectations, and the growth in legal channel activity is consistent with their forecasts [93]

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- Net sales for Q4 2025 increased by 4.4% to $291.3 million compared to $279.2 million in Q4 2024, with comparable sales up 2.2% [12][17] - Full-year net sales for fiscal 2025 were $929.1 million, a 4.5% increase from $889.2 million in 2024, with comparable sales up 4.3% [17][19] - Gross margin for Q4 2025 was 38.2%, up from 36.2% in Q4 2024, driven by product margin improvement [15][19] - Operating income for Q4 was $25 million, or 8.6% of net sales, compared to $20.1 million, or 7.2% of net sales in the prior year [16][20] - Net income for Q4 was $19.6 million, or $1.16 per share, compared to $14.8 million, or $0.78 per share in the previous year [17][21]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- Men's category led positive comparable sales growth during the holiday period, followed by women's, accessories, and hardgoods [4][14] - Footwear was the only negative comping category [14][55] - Private label penetration reached approximately 30% of sales in 2025, up from 12% five years ago [7]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- North America net sales for Q4 were $224.4 million, an increase of 4.8% from 2024, with comparable sales up 5.5% [12][13] - Other international net sales, which include Europe and Australia, were $66.9 million, up 3% from last year, but comparable sales declined 7.5% in Q4 [13][19] - For fiscal 2025, North America net sales were $757 million, a 5.1% increase from 2024, while other international net sales were $172 million, up 1.7% [18][19]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company is focused on three strategic priorities: driving revenue growth through consumer-focused initiatives, optimizing profitability, and managing volatility while funding strategic expansion [6][9] - The commitment to refreshing the product mix with innovative offerings has been a cornerstone of success, with over 150 new brands launched in 2025 [7][8] - The company plans to open five new stores in 2026 while closing approximately 25 stores, including 20 in North America and five internationally [33][70]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management expressed confidence in the ability to generate value despite economic volatility and evolving global dynamics [10] - The company anticipates total sales growth of 3%-5% for Q1 2026, with comparable sales expected to be between 2% and 4% [27][30] - Management highlighted the importance of maintaining operational discipline and delivering distinctive merchandise to drive growth [10][32] Other Important Information - The company ended the year with cash and current marketable securities of $160.6 million, up from $147.6 million the previous year [21][22] - The company repurchased 2.7 million shares during fiscal 2025 at an average cost of $14.18 per share, totaling $38.3 million [23] Q&A Session Summary Question: What is the situation in Europe regarding comparable sales? - Management indicated that Europe was the primary driver of the international comp performance, with a strategic shift towards full price selling showing positive results [36][37] Question: Why is the comp guidance for the quarter lower than current performance? - Management noted that while February was strong, there was observed softness in early March due to global conflicts and rising fuel prices [44][45] Question: How did private label perform compared to branded products during the holiday season? - Management stated that there were no significant changes in trends between private label and branded products, with both performing well [49][50] Question: What are the plans for store openings and closures? - Management confirmed plans to open five new stores while closing approximately 25, focusing on profitability and cash flow [67][70]

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- Revenue for 2025 increased by 20% to approximately $2.2 million, compared to $1.86 million in 2024. Excluding a temporary revenue impact from the transition to managing Amazon sales, full-year revenue growth would have been closer to 30% [6][10] - Gross margin improved to 62.5% in 2025 from 54.1% in 2024, reflecting an improved product mix and a growing contribution from e-commerce channels [10] - The company reported a net loss of $6.4 million in 2025, compared to a net loss of $6.2 million in 2024. Adjusted net loss for the year would have been approximately $5.6 million when excluding one-time legal expenses [10][11]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- E-commerce revenue increased by 88% in 2025, driven by strong growth on Amazon and the direct-to-consumer website, now representing more than half of total revenue [8] - Municipal markets are seeing increased interest in fertility control approaches, with ongoing programs in cities like New York and Chicago [8][9]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- Internationally, the company expanded its footprint with regulatory approvals in New Zealand and new distribution relationships in Belize [9] - The company is in discussions with potential deployment partners in New York City as the trial of Evolve concludes [9]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company's core strategy remains focused on scaling current initiatives and maintaining resource allocation discipline while searching for a new CEO [5] - The company aims to accelerate growth in e-commerce, municipal adoption, and technology validation while managing operating expenses carefully [11] Management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management expressed optimism about the potential for growth in 2026, aiming for higher revenue growth rates than in 2025 [13] - The company is focused on maintaining financial discipline while investing in areas with traction, such as e-commerce and municipal markets [11] Other Important Information - The legal dispute with Liphatech has been resolved satisfactorily, with all litigation dismissed [10][22] - The company ended 2025 with $8.6 million in cash and short-term investments, providing a solid operating runway [11] Q&A Session Summary Question: Should we expect similar growth rates in 2026 as in 2025? - Management indicated that growth could be higher, aiming to accelerate growth in profitable areas [13] Question: What will contribute to 2026 revenues? - Revenue will come from a mix of e-commerce, municipal orders, and international expansion [14][15] Question: What is the status of the court case with Liphatech? - The case has been settled satisfactorily, and the company does not expect recurring legal costs related to this issue [22][23] Question: What is the status of product registration in Australia? - Regulatory authorities are expected to provide a response in the spring regarding product registration [25] Question: Will the new CEO have incentives based on stock performance? - Yes, a meaningful portion of the CEO's compensation is expected to be equity-based and aligned with long-term shareholder value [56] Question: How is the agricultural sector performing? - The agricultural sector is performing well, with expansions in various areas including almond groves and poultry [33] Question: Will the company expand its sales team? - Yes, the company plans to expand its sales team to maximize B2B sales efforts [60]

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- Total revenue for the full year 2025 was $185.3 million, down 2% year-over-year from $189.9 million in 2024 [10] - Advertising revenue declined 3% to $91.7 million, while programmatic advertising grew 7% to $69.6 million, representing 76% of total advertising revenue [10] - Adjusted EBITDA improved 61% to $8.8 million compared to $5.5 million in 2024 [11] - Net loss from continuing operations was $57.3 million compared to $34 million in 2024, reflecting a non-cash goodwill impairment charge of $30.2 million [11]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- Studio revenue nearly tripled to $16.1 million, driven by the delivery of three feature films and contributions from the micro drama category [10] - Content revenue increased 9% to $37 million, while direct sold content declined 26% to $21 million [11] - Commerce and other revenue declined 8% to $56.5 million, with affiliate commerce declining 7% to $55.5 million [11]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- Time spent totaled 276.5 million hours, down 7% year-over-year, expected due to elevated engagement during the presidential election cycle in 2024 [12] - Q4 revenue was $56.5 million, up 1% year-over-year, with advertising revenue increasing slightly to $25.6 million [14] - Programmatic advertising grew 2% to $18.4 million, while direct sold advertising declined 3% to $7.2 million [14]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company believes it is undervalued, with the current market value not reflecting the strength of its individual brands and innovative work [4] - The focus is on closing the gap between market valuation and the intrinsic value of assets, particularly through new products and AI-driven experiences [9] - The company is exploring strategic options to unlock value and address liquidity challenges, with an update on strategic direction expected in the coming quarters [15]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management acknowledges the challenges posed by legacy costs and a pessimistic view of digital media, but believes in the potential of unlaunched products and forthcoming features [5] - The company is committed to demonstrating the value of its assets and innovative work, particularly in AI and new product experiences [8] - Guidance for 2026 is being withheld due to ongoing evaluations of strategic opportunities [15] Other Important Information - The company ended the year with cash and cash equivalents of approximately $27.7 million, a decrease of $10.9 million compared to 2024 [12] - Total debt as of December 31, 2025, was $60.2 million, with $45 million in term loans and $15.2 million in film financing arrangements [13] Q&A Session Summary - No specific questions or answers were provided in the content, thus this section is not applicable.

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- For the full year 2025, the company reported revenue of $175 million, a decline of approximately 5% from $185 million in 2024, with fourth-quarter revenue at $43 million, down 10% year-over-year [4][14] - Adjusted EBITDA for the full year was $40 million, compared to $43 million in 2024, reflecting the company's cost control efforts despite revenue decline [17] - The company ended the year with $62 million in cash, marking a nearly 20% increase from the end of 2024 [4]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- Average paying clients in the fourth quarter were 5,120, down approximately 2% year-over-year and sequentially, with a full-year average of 5,091, up 2% compared to 2024 [14][15] - Average revenue per paying client for both the fourth quarter and the full year was approximately $2,800, down from prior year levels due to lower spending from existing clients [15]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company experienced severe pricing compression and competition from illicit markets, particularly affecting mature markets like California and Michigan, where total retail sales and average retail prices declined year-over-year [13] - Encouraging growth was noted in newer markets such as New York and Ohio, where client penetration was prioritized, although this growth did not offset pressures in mature markets [14]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company remains focused on enhancing product offerings and deepening relationships with large California-based clients and MSO partners, while also improving marketplace experience [8] - Investments in technology and team development are planned to support long-term growth, despite the challenging industry environment [11]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management highlighted that many industry dynamics affecting clients in 2025 are expected to persist into 2026, with first-quarter revenue anticipated to decline sequentially by mid- to high-single digits from the fourth quarter [17] - The company expressed optimism about growth levers and product updates aimed at improving consumer engagement and e-commerce experience [11] Other Important Information - The company recorded a non-cash asset impairment charge of approximately $7.8 million in the fourth quarter, primarily related to goodwill [16] - Management remains cautious about the potential impact of Schedule III on the business model, emphasizing that it will not lead to immediate changes in operational capabilities [9][10] Q&A Session Summary - No specific questions or answers were provided in the content regarding the Q&A session.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- Fourth quarter revenues reached $290 million, an increase of 9% year-over-year, with a gross profit percentage of 23%, up four percentage points from the prior year [8][19] - Full year consolidated revenues were $1.069 billion, an increase of $26 million or 2%, with a gross profit percentage of 22%, up from 19% in the previous year [9][24] - GAAP net loss for the fourth quarter was $108 million compared to a net income of $26 million in the fourth quarter of 2024, primarily due to excise tax expenses and a loss on early debt extinguishment [20][25] - Operational EBITDA for the fourth quarter was $22 million, up 144% year-over-year, driven by improved pricing and higher volume [22]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- The AM&C segment saw a revenue increase of 25% in the fourth quarter, attributed to the launch of a direct distribution brand of still films [10] - The print division experienced growth in North America, particularly in the plates division, with the PROSPER 520 moving to full production [11] - Brand licensing continues to grow, contributing significantly to profit and increasing awareness of Kodak, especially in Asia [11]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company reported a strong performance despite global economic and geopolitical uncertainties, with revenue increases across both AM&C and print segments [19] - The film group has seen a resurgence, with several Oscar nominees shot on Kodak film, indicating a positive market response [10] Company Strategy and Development Direction - Kodak's long-term plan remains on track, focusing on growth following a strong 2025, with a commitment to customer-first strategies [5][29] - The company has streamlined operations and reduced operating expenses by over $200 million, positioning itself for future growth [7][8] - Investments in new products and infrastructure are ongoing, with a focus on the pharma division and battery coating technologies [30][31]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management expressed confidence in the company's strong balance sheet and operational improvements, which are expected to support future growth [6][29] - The leadership team has undergone significant changes to enhance the company's fundamentals and drive growth [32] Other Important Information - Kodak completed a pension reversion process that generated approximately $1.023 billion, significantly strengthening its balance sheet and reducing ongoing interest expenses [13][14] - The company ended 2025 with $337 million in unrestricted cash, reflecting operational improvements and proceeds from the KRIP settlement [27] Summary of Q&A Session - There was no formal Q&A session during the call, but the investor relations team is available for follow-up inquiries [4]

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company ended Q4 with a record net new subscription ARR growth of $115 million, significantly exceeding expectations [5] - Subscription ARR reached $1.46 billion, growing 34% year-over-year [20] - Subscription revenue was $365 million, up 50% year-over-year, contributing to total revenue of $378 million, which increased by 46% [22] - Free cash flow for Q4 was $70 million, while for the full fiscal year, it was $238 million, compared to $22 million in the prior fiscal year [25][29] - Non-GAAP gross margin improved to 84% from 80% year-over-year [23]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- The adoption of Rubrik Security Cloud resulted in $1.29 billion of cloud ARR, up 48%, representing 88% of subscription ARR [21] - The number of customers contributing $100,000 or more in subscription ARR rose by 25% to 2,805, now representing 87% of subscription ARR [22] - The identity line of business saw rapid growth, crossing 900 customers in just a few quarters [49]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- Revenue from the Americas grew 45% to $268 million, while revenue from outside the Americas grew 51% to $109 million [23] - The company reported a strong subscription net retention rate of over 120% [21]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company is focused on advancing its mission to secure and accelerate AI transformation, with a unique platform that integrates data, identity, and application context [6][19] - Rubrik is positioning itself as a leader in the cyber resilience market, leveraging its differentiated technology platform to capture emerging opportunities in AI and identity security [20][29] - The company plans to invest in R&D and go-to-market strategies to target regions and verticals with attractive ROI [26]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management expressed confidence in the robust cyber resilience market and the company's ability to achieve strong growth in subscription ARR [26] - The company anticipates continued operational investments to drive innovation in data security and AI [26] - Management highlighted the importance of maintaining a strong cash position and optimizing capital structure to support growth [25] Other Important Information - The company has made Rubrik Agent Cloud generally available, with ongoing POCs across early AI adopters and Fortune 500 companies [17] - The company is actively engaged in the emerging sovereign cloud market, responding to geopolitical concerns regarding data sovereignty [39][41] Q&A Session Summary Question: Insights on Agent Cloud POCs with Fortune 500 and AI startups - Management indicated that customers are focused on understanding and controlling the agents in their systems, with monitoring and guardrail solutions being high priorities [32][34] Question: Customer impetus for Rubrik Sovereign Cloud - Management noted that geopolitical concerns have driven countries to seek data sovereignty, leading to the development of dedicated products in this area [39][41] Question: Concerns about AI impacting core business value - Management reassured that Rubrik's complex software and its role as a system of record for data and identity will remain critical, even as AI evolves [70][71] Question: Dynamics of Q4 performance and Q1 guidance - Management clarified that while Q4 was strong, they do not expect significant pull-forward effects impacting Q1 guidance [78] Question: Competitive environment and legacy vendor displacement - Management stated that they are early in the legacy replacement process, with a win rate exceeding 90% against data protection vendors [83]

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- Revenue for Q4 2025 was $69.3 million, exceeding the high end of guidance, primarily driven by higher variable revenue [38] - Adjusted EBITDA for Q4 was $10.8 million, also above the high end of guidance, due to cost restructuring and disciplined operational execution [38] - Recurring revenue constituted 89% of total revenue, amounting to $52.9 million, while professional services revenue was $8.3 million, down 36% year-over-year [39] - Average revenue per customer increased by 9% year-over-year to $680,000 [40] - Cash on the balance sheet at the end of Q4 was $95 million [41]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- Revenue from hosted services was $51 million, down 15% year-over-year [39] - Net revenue retention decreased to 78% in Q4, down from 80% in Q3 [40]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- Over 20% of all conversations in Q4 leveraged the company's Generative AI tools, indicating strong adoption [16] - The company signed 40 deals in Q4, including four new logos and 36 expansions, reflecting a slight sequential increase in total deal value [33]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company is focusing on three primary areas: customer growth and retention, innovation in the Conversational Cloud platform, and expanding technology partnerships [7] - The launch of Syntrix is seen as a significant innovation that addresses market gaps in AI deployment assurance [9][10] - The company aims to transition to a unified architecture to support higher generative AI traffic and improve resiliency [18][29]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management expressed confidence in achieving positive net new ARR in the second half of 2026, despite expected revenue declines throughout the year [30][42] - The company anticipates that a material fraction of total revenue will flow through the Google Cloud Marketplace by the end of 2026, enhancing customer retention [35][75] Other Important Information - The company is on track to complete its multi-year platform modernization in the first half of 2026, which is foundational for long-term scalability [17][29] - The partnership with Google Cloud is delivering significant early results, simplifying procurement and enhancing customer relationships [19][75] Q&A Session Summary Question: Can you walk us through the decrease in total OpEx for Q4 and expectations for 2026? - Management indicated that the decrease was primarily due to a large restructuring executed in the prior quarter, with some one-time items, and that investments in innovation are expected to increase OpEx in 2026 [51] Question: How does the expected positive net new ARR in the second half reconcile with revenue declines? - Management clarified that historical customer losses will offset the positive revenue from net new ARR, leading to sequential revenue declines throughout 2026 [55] Question: Can you expand on the demand for Syntrix and its development? - Management noted that demand for simulation capabilities led to the development of Syntrix, which addresses broader challenges in AI deployment and compliance [59][62] Question: What is the pricing model for Syntrix and its impact on renewals? - The pricing model for Syntrix is conversation-based, and early indications show it serves as both an upsell opportunity and a retention capability for existing customers [68][70] Question: How does Google Cloud Marketplace impact the sales pipeline? - Management stated that Google Cloud Marketplace serves as a retention lever, simplifying procurement and potentially leading to new customer opportunities [73][75]

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- Fourth quarter net revenue was $118 million, a decline of 19% year-over-year compared to $446.1 million in the prior year period [16] - Full year net revenue was $319.9 million, a decline of 14% year-over-year compared to $372.8 million in 2024 [18] - Fourth quarter gross margins reached 40.1%, a year-over-year improvement of nearly 310 basis points [16] - Full year gross margins of 37.3% represented an improvement of 270 basis points year-over-year, marking the highest annual level since 2018 [18] - Net income for the fourth quarter was $17.6 million, compared to $20.1 million in the prior year period [16] - Full year net income was $15.7 million, representing a 3% year-over-year decline compared to $16.2 million in 2024 [18]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company gained share in its core Turtle Beach headset brand despite overall market softness [6] - The racing sim product line is performing well, with share gains year-over-year [27] - The company plans to launch over 50% more new products in 2026 compared to 2025, with innovations across all categories [8][29]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- The gaming accessories market experienced unexpected softness, particularly in North America [5] - The company anticipates a console refresh cycle in the coming years, which typically drives increased hardware adoption and accessory demand [8] - The upcoming release of Grand Theft Auto VI is expected to significantly impact gaming engagement and accessory demand [7]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company is focused on capitalizing on the anticipated accessories upgrade and replacement cycle over the next 24 months [6] - A comprehensive refinancing strategy has improved financial flexibility and reduced the cost of capital [11] - The company remains disciplined in capital allocation, actively assessing bolt-on acquisitions while prioritizing share repurchases [14][15]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management expressed optimism about the trajectory of the business moving into 2026, despite current market headwinds [8] - The company expects full year 2026 revenue to be in the range of $335 million-$355 million, representing 8% growth at the midpoint compared to 2025 [21] - Management believes that the pressures faced in 2025 were cyclical and that the company is well-positioned for future growth [24] Other Important Information - The company repurchased approximately 1.35 million shares for about $19 million in 2025, with a new two-year $75 million share repurchase program authorized [12][20] - The board of directors has seen changes, with William Wyatt appointed as chairman following Terry Jimenez's departure [16] Q&A Session Summary Question: How are the racing sim products performing and what about the 50% more products for 2026? - The racing sim products are performing well with share gains, and the 50% increase in new products will span across all categories [27][29] Question: Can you provide a revenue range related to GTA VI for your guidance? - The second half of the year is expected to be strong, with GTA VI contributing significantly to growth [33] Question: What are the expectations for gross margin versus OpEx in 2026? - Continued improvements in gross margin are expected, with a similar OpEx structure to 2025 [39] Question: Will there be an increase in spending on G&A and marketing? - Additional investments in brand and marketing are anticipated, included in the guidance [50] Question: What is the current state of retail inventories? - Retail inventories ended the year lighter, but no further declines are expected, with potential for expansion [51] Question: What is the outlook for the next 12 months compared to the previous period? - A significantly better outlook is anticipated for the next 12 months, driven by new product launches and GTA VI [55] Question: What are the drivers of optimism beyond GTA VI? - Multiple factors including the overdue accessories replacement cycle and new product innovations are driving optimism [66]
